To fix the u11f9 automobile fault code, check the possible causes and inspect the wiring harness, connectors, and components for damage.

  • To fix the automobile fault code u11f9, first, check the possible causes listed above.
  • Then, visually inspect the related wiring harness and connectors.
  • Look for damaged components and check for bro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ded connector’s pins.

The u11f9 fault code is a Diagnostic Trouble Code (DTC) that indicates a problem with the Adaptive Cruise Control (ACC) Module torque request.

This fault code is set when the Module detects that the Powertrain Control Module is not responding to the ACC Module torque request. The code specifically indicates that the engine did not respond to the Adaptive Cruise Control torque request.
